无锡软件测试工程师培训告诉你软件测试人员该具备的素质:
首先,要有宽泛的计算机基础知识。微机原理,数据结构,数据库,操作系统原理,编译原理,逻辑,编程语言,网络,等等,都要系统地学习过。都精通不大可能,因为人的兴趣都不相同,但是,这些功课的基本知识点是应当了解的。我们在谈到职业的类别的时候,我们可以说C程序员,C#程序员,Java程序员,而没有C测试员,C#测试员,Java测试员,程序员可以只擅长某1门编程语言,测试员却不行。为什么呢?测试员是代表用户的,在做测试的时候,他(她)需要考虑到方方面面的事情。例如对于1个用C写的上网拨号程序,测试员需要考虑:
(1)程序的功能是否正确;(要求计算机知识)
(2)是否符合用户的使用习惯;(要求界面设计知识和换位思考能力)
(3)性能是否满足要求,例如长时间使用;稳定性;(要求深入的计算机知识)
(4)是否能够满足用户可能的不同操作系统的要求;(要求计算机知识)
(5)如果在全球发布,是否满足不同语言和文化的需求;(要求软件国际化测试知识)
(6)如何搭建测试环境;(动手能力,硬件知识)
(7)做代码检查;(比较深入的C语言知识)
(8)(相对于这个软件来说的其他要求)
所以,各方面都了解1点,你在做测试的过程当中你会感觉顺手的多。如果某写方面还差1些,没有关系,计算机行业的特点就是边做边学,只要是个有心人,学习是很快的。
其次,要掌握1门编程语言。有的朋友可能会说,我就是不愿意做编程才来做测试的,怎么测试还有这么1个要求?我要尝试说服你:)。我的理由有两个:
1.只有知道怎么做1个软件产品,才能真正懂得这个产品。而只有真正懂得了产品,才能做好测试。1行代码不会,你会始终是个门外汉。不要满足于点鼠标,而去尝试着打开我们面前的黑盒子。
2.自动化测试技术需要编程技术。自动化测试是软件测试的1个发展方向,1方面很多测试工具都需要人工干预,编写代码;另1方面在有的情况下需要自己编写测试工具。
对于测试员来说,编程技术不要求精通,但要会。
再次,学好英语。在现阶段,我们只能承认,在计算机方面,英语。有很多的资料都是英语的,如果仅仅局限在中文资料方面,会影响你的渊博程度。举1个简单的例子,Windows操作系统会捕捉到1些程序或者操作系统内部的异常,你可以根据这个异常到微软上去查找错误原因和解决办法,其中有很大1部分资料就是英文的,因为还没有翻译过来或者以后也不会翻译的。
无锡软件测试工程师培训上哪找?无锡软件测试工程师辅导机构学多久?无锡软件测试工程师培训哪个好?无锡软件测试工程师辅导机构哪家好?尽快联系了解详情哦!
★师资力量
★学校环境
以上就是软件测试培训课程的全部内容介绍,如需了解更多的软件测试培训班、课程、价格、试听等信息,也可以点击进入 软件测试 相关频道,定制专属课程,开始您的学习之旅。